Yahoo: Wanna be a Social Media Producer?

Yahoo! is setting the bar for who is qualified to be called a Social Media Expert and they’re putting a figure on the number of connections you need to have. Check out the list below if you qualify.

Here’s the checklist:

  • 3 to 5 years editorial experience (includes blogging)
  • Minimum 400 friends on Facebook
  • Minimum 300 followers in Twitter
  • Minimum 200 connections in LinkedIn

Looks like a reasonable criteria which means you need to be a bit popular among social media sites to qualify (I wonder why they didn’t include Friendster). If you asked me, the hardest number to achieve is LinkedIn.
